Aiming higher: Promoting safety in air taxi operations he air taxi sector provides a diverse array of aerial services to Canadians. Whether it be transporting patients to hospitals, providing search and rescue support, or delivering food, equipment, and passengers to small communities, the vital air links developed by this aviation sector have helped Canada build and sustain its population. However, there is also a more troubling side to the sector: the air taxi segment has more accidents, causing more fatalities, than all other sectors in commercial aviation in Canada combined. UNDERSTANDING THE PROBLEM To determine the underlying reasons for such an elevated toll, the Transportation Safety Board of Canada (TSB) conducted a four-year study of air taxi operations in Canada. We examined over 700 occurrences, analyzed approximately 300 hours of recordings, and interviewed 125 individuals from the air taxi sector and from Transport Canada. By interviewing such a wide segment of the industry — people whose backgrounds included medevac, floatplane and helicopter operations — we determined that the answer was partly because of the nature of the work. This wasn’t that surprising; air taxi pilots often have no set schedule and fly into remote areas in uncontrolled airspace with few or no aerodromes; flights tend to be shorter, resulting in more takeoffs and landings; and weather exposes smaller aircraft to challenging work conditions, as these aircraft typically fly at lower altitudes and over rugged, coastal, or northern topography. But the larger reason for so many accidents boils down to two things: an acceptance of unsafe practices, and the inadequate management of operational hazards. Simply put, certain practices have become accepted as the “normal” way to conduct business. As these unsafe practices become more ingrained in the culture of the sector, and as flights are carried out successfully (though not necessarily safely), the associated risks become just “part of the job,” and therefore difficult to detect and reduce. BALANCING COMPETING PRESSURES Like any business, air taxi operators face competing pressures — pressures that they must balance in order to deliver a service, stay safe, and also stay economically viable. But those pressures are always shifting, pushing operations toward certain boundaries (see Figure 1). In the first two frames, you can see the three competing pressures, and what operations look like when they are in relative balance. In the third frame, you can see that the pressures are out of balance, and the flight is operating at the margin of safety, where there is an increased risk of an accident. In the final frame, the flight is operating outside of the safety margin, where the likelihood of an accident is greatest. NEW TSB RECOMMENDATIONS To increase the safety pressure, the TSB issued four new recommendations in its report on air taxi safety. The TSB recommended that: • Transport Canada (TC) collaborate with industry associations to develop strategies, education products, and tools to help air taxi operators and their clients eliminate the acceptance of unsafe practices; • industry associations promote pro- active safety management processes and safety culture with air taxi opera- tors to address the safety deficiencies identified in this safety issue investi- gation through training and sharing of best practices, tools and safety data specific to air taxi operations; • TC review the gaps identified in this safety issue investigation regarding Subpart 703 of the Canadian Aviation Regulations and associated standards, and update the relevant regulations and standards; and • TC require all commercial operators to collect and report hours flown and movement data for their aircraft by Canadian Aviation Regulations subpart and aircraft type, and that TC publish those data. If Transport Canada and industry take action on these new recommendations, as well as an additional 22 TSB recommenda- tions previously aimed at this sector, that will go a long way to raising the bar on safe- ty for the air taxi industry in Canada. Seriously, while society as a whole continues to wrestle with the persistent challenge of alcohol abuse, we now add cannabis to the list of things to avoid when climbing into an aircraft’s cockpit or cabin as well as when doing maintenance work, etc. It’s especially problematic with the advent of “edibles” such as cookies and chewable candies which contain THC. That doesn’t stand for “The Healthy Choice” and it is not a candidate for the Canada Food Guide. Rather, it’s tetrahydrocannabinol, the tongue- and mind-twisting psychoactive element in marijuana which acts much like the body’s natural cannabinoids. THC attaches to cannabinoid receptors in areas of the brain associated with, among other things, pleasure. Hence “getting high.” But it also can induce hallucinations and delusions as well as potentially impairing motor skills for several hours after an “edible” intake. The U.S. National Highway Traffic Safety Administration reports that as a psychoactive substance, THC is second only to alcohol detected in motorists – but unlike alcohol, it so far is hard to “breathalyze.” Checking a smoker can be straightforward because that form of cannabis tends to stink. Not so much the flood of other ingestibles which are now legal in much of Canada but are, parenthetically, an issue when entering the U.S. or the dozens of other countries which maintain a hard line on drugs of any kind. As people become more accepting of cannabis, they should know that edibles can have quite different effects compared to smoking a joint. Rather than resulting in an immediate hit through the lungs, it can take much longer to manifest itself as it travels through our gut, and the effects can be persistent. That’s bad enough in a car and even worse when there are only two wheels and two dimensions to manage. Aircraft and airport operations obviously take it, literally and figuratively, to a whole other level. It’s seven months or so since Transport Canada addressed the issue in an Aviation Safety Letter, in which it set out a policy prohibiting flight crews and con- trollers from consuming cannabis for at least 28 days before going on duty. Built on a Canadian Aviation Regulations fitness for duty requirement and based on “the best available science,” the Transport directive does not preclude operators imposing even stricter rules. So, with that in hand, I asked the Canadian Air Transport Security Authority (CATSA), the Air Canada Pilots Association (ACPA) and Transport for a sitrep. My principal question was whether there have been any disciplinary actions not only against air crews but also ground employees and high-flying passengers. CATSA, to give it its due, is not mandated to confirm “impairment of passengers or airport workers.” It pointed out in an email that its priority is “the highest levels of security” for travellers. However, when staff do encounter “problematic” passengers or airport workers, “they are trained to handle these situations in order to proceed with the screening process.” If a situation can’t be “defused,” it added, police and/or the carrier are called in and when something that’s outright illegal is involved, just the police. ACPA’s response was minimal. “As the policies/procedures surrounding cannabis and flight crews originate with Transport Canada and Air Canada, they are best positioned to comment if you have not reached out to them already.” I had. Transport pointed me back to the June 2019 policy which, it said, “supports safe recruitment into and return to flying through successful treatment of Substance Use Disorders and other health conditions previously treated with cannabis.” It also pointed out that civil aviation medicine only tests for drugs when diagnosing and treating conditions such as the aforementioned disorders. That said, “no enforcement measures have been taken to date since the . . . policy came into effect.” Hopefully, it’ll remain that way because the obvious long-term risk clearly isn’t worth a short-term reward, no matter the form in which the stuff is ingested. BRENT JANG | AIRLINE NEWS When Onex Corp. completed its $3.5-billion acquisition of WestJet Airlines Ltd. in December, it marked a major milestone in the carrier’s history. The Toronto-based private equity firm, led by billionaire Gerry Schwartz, paid $31 a share for Calgary-based WestJet. Including the assumption of WestJet’s $1.5-billion in debt, the enterprise value of the transaction totals $5 billion. WestJet chief executive officer Ed Sims, who leads the airline with 14,000 employ- ees, said he’s looking forward to collabo- rating with Onex. “These are deeply intellectual people who are going to add an awful lot of structuring and financial horsepower to the capability we already have in the organization,” said Sims in an interview with Skies. “It’s a formidable combination to bring these two organizations together.” Sims, who was born in Wales, has an eclectic background. He graduated with a degree in English from Oxford University in 1985 and has worked in the tourism and aviation sectors for more than 30 years, with experience in Britain, Europe, Australia and New Zealand before arriving in Canada. Sims left air navigation service provider Airways New Zealand to join WestJet in May 2017 as commercial vice-president. He has been WestJet’s CEO since March 2018, taking over from Gregg Saretsky, who had served in the top job for almost eight years. WestJet has steadily expanded from hum- ble beginnings, launching with three used Boeing 737-200s in February 1996, and staffed by employees called WestJetters. ITPS Photo SKIESMAG.COM February/March 2020 18 BRIEFING ROOM | AVIATION INDUSTRY NEWS HOWARD SLUTSKEN | OEM NEWS Boeing’s brand-new 777-9 jetliner took to the air for the first time on Jan. 25 – the largest twin-engine airliner ever – ushering in efficiencies for its airline customers, and improvements in the passenger experience. The plane’s maiden flight was three hours and 51 minutes in duration, with pilots reporting the 777-9 “flew beautifully” during a detailed test plan that exercised its systems and structures. “Today’s safe first flight of the 777X is a tribute to the years of hard work and dedication from our teammates, our suppliers and our community partners in Washington state and across the globe,” said Stan Deal, president and CEO of Boeing Commercial Airplanes. The first of four dedicated 777-9 flight test airplanes, WH001 was set to undergo testing before flights resume. The 777-9, the first of the new 777X series, will seat between 400 and 425 passengers, and fly up to 14,000 kilometres. The 77-metre-long twin- aisle jet is powered by two new massive General Electric GE9X turbofans. Each generating 105,000 pounds of thrust, the 3.4-metre-diameter GE9X is the largest turbofan engine ever created and was specifically designed for the 777X. The huge aircraft’s first flight was delayed by six months when testing uncovered an issue with a component of the GE9X, requiring the redesign of a compressor stator. With an all-new wing, new engines and updated systems and flight deck, the 777X is nearly an all-new aircraft, and just shares the 777 designation with its successful predecessor that first flew 25 years ago, in 1994. Boeing re-shaped the fuselage frames of the plane to add about 10 cm of interior cabin width, which could translate to slightly wider seats in a 10-across economy configuration. At a time when it’s becoming a challenge to tell one aircraft type from another at an airport, the 777X will be uniquely identifiable on the ramp. To optimize the new design’s aerodynamic efficiency, the 777X is fitted with an advanced carbon fibre composite wing, with a huge wingspan of almost 72 metres – and the wing has a trick up its sleeve. Just like aircraft carrier-based planes, the 777X’s wingtips fold upwards while the airliner is on the ground, reducing the total wingspan by about seven metres. The wing- fold mechanism shortens the 777X’s wingspan to match that of the current 777-300ER and -200LR, so that the new plane can use existing terminal gates and airport taxiways. The wing-fold process is automated on landing, with the tips folding below 50 knots during the roll-out to reduce workload, before the pilots turn onto a taxiway made for the smaller 777s. Before takeoff, pilots will manually unfold the wingtips, a 20-second long operation that’s supported by an item on the plane’s electronic checklist. Eight airlines including Lufthansa, British Airways, Singapore Airlines and Cathay Pacific have ordered over 300 aircraft, with the first 777-9 targeted to enter service with Emirates in 2021. British Airways has said that the 777-9 will replace that airline’s fleet of large wide-bodies, primarily its aging 747-400s, the “Queen of the Skies.” The 777-9 that now begins flight testing was to be joined by the 777-8, its smaller, but longer-ranged sibling. Seating between 350 and 375 passengers, the 777-8 would be able to fly the world’s longest routes, with a range of over 16,000 km. However, Boeing has frozen the development of the 777-8 until at least early 2021, citing uncertain demand for the jet. Since 1995, over 1,500 Boeing 777s have been delivered to airlines around the world, including more than two dozen to Air Canada. The airline took delivery of its first 777- 300ER in March 2007, and its first long- range 777-200LR in June 2007. With a total fleet of 25 aircraft – 19 777-300ERs and six 777-200LRs – the wide-body jets service high-density and long-range international and domestic routes. Might aviation enthusiasts see a folded- wing 777X in Air Canada colours, taxiing up to a gate at a Canadian airport? Not likely, according to Mark Galardo, vice-president, Network Planning at Air Canada, who said that the current fleet still has lots of flying to do. “We continuously look at all new aircraft and see no need for further adjustments for the foreseeable future. We’re satisfied with our current 777 fleet that hasn’t even hit mid-life yet, and therefore see no changes to this particular fleet.” Other airlines now flying 777s may echo Galardo’s comments, and Boeing might find that to be the biggest challenge facing this enormous new airliner as the airframer tries to best the plane’s incredibly popular predecessor. KEN POLE | OEM NEWS As The Boeing Company struggles with arguably the worst crisis in its 103- year history, digging out of a financial black hole left by the worldwide grounding of its popular 737 Max series, its new president and chief executive officer, David Calhoun, remains optimistic about recovery. “We have a lot of work to do,” he acknowledged during a Jan. 29 conference call with industry analysts and media after only 16 days on the job. “I’m confident we’ll manage the situation. . . . We will be transparent in everything that we do.” During the call, the aerospace giant reported a full-year net loss of $636 million, its largest on record and the first in more than 20 years. In addition, Boeing appears to be grappling with issues surrounding other aircraft programs as well, announcing that it plans to slow production of the 787 Dreamliner to 10 per month — down from 12 — next year. Calhoun said in a prepared statement ahead of the call that Boeing is “focused on returning the 737 Max to service safely and restoring the long-standing trust that the Boeing brand represents with the flying public. . . . Safety will underwrite every decision, every action and every step we take.” The global Max fleet was grounded last March after two crashes in five months – October 2018 in Indonesia and March 2019 in Ethiopia – killed 346 people. It has been generally acknowledged that a flight control system software conflict was the underlying cause of the catastrophes. The latest cost of the fleet being grounded and production and deliveries suspended is projected to be $18.4 billion as the Chicago- based OEM waits for regulators to green light the aircraft’s return to service, which Calhoun expects in mid-2020. In the meantime, Boeing is taking on some $12 billion in new debt to support its recovery. A key element of the overall cost of dealing with the Max fallout is $4 billion identified as “abnormal production costs,” most of them to be incurred this year. This includes supporting Max program suppliers. There have been layoffs at some U.S. suppliers with more expected as a return to Max production and deliveries remains stalled. There are more than 600 Boeing suppliers in Canada. “We’re engaged at all tiers of the supply chain and have been for quite some time,” Greg Smith, Boeing’s chief financial officer and executive vice-president of enterprise performance and strategy, added during the call. “It’s in all of our best interests to make sure they are healthy.” Counting on Boeing’s services division and its defence, space and security arm to provide some overall relief from the impact on its commercial aircraft division, Smith pointed out that there is a seven-year backlog of some 4,400 737-family aircraft. However, there’s also the challenge of regaining trust in the Max platform. A Bank of America Merrill Lynch survey of more than 2,000 respondents in December indicated that two-thirds would wait at least six months before flying again in a Max. Some said that if given an option, they would choose another aircraft. “I wish the moment was different, but . . . we will get through this,” Calhoun said, apologizing to the families of the Lion Air and Ethiopian Airlines crashes and adding that he expected to be doing so “many, many” times as the investigations and legal fallout continue. Isaac Capua - isaac@aviationunlimited.com | 905 477 0107 | aviationunlimited.com | OEM NEWS Airbus’s long-awaited BelugaXL formally entered into service for the European OEM on Jan. 13. The aircraft is the first of six hefty cargo planes to be introduced to Airbus’s fleet, which will replace the BelugaST that is based on the company’s A300-600. The aircraft are used to carry completed sections of Airbus aircraft from different production sites around Europe to the final assembly lines in Toulouse, France and Hamburg, Germany. The XL is based on Airbus’s A330 and measures seven metres longer than the ST, which the company said provides a 30 per cent increase in transport capacity. The massive freighter can carry two of the A350 XWV’s wings as opposed to only one for the BelugaST. The aircraft measures 63.1 metres long. From the bottom of the fuselage to the top of the cargo hold, it is 18.9 metres high, equivalent to a three- to-four storey building and with a maximum payload of 51 tonnes. The BelugaXL is powered by a pair of twin Rolls-Royce Trent 700 turbofan engines, and it needs all that power to move the 63x8 metre cargo bay – the largest cross-section of any cargo aircraft in the world. With a range of 2,200 nautical miles and a cruising speed of Mach 0.69, the fleet of massive planes is set to fly more than four million miles per year. Aside from the technical aspects, the BelugaXL fully embodies its namesake. The cargo hold and fuselage combined form the shape of a beluga whale, and Airbus really leaned into the design by painting each XL with eyes and a mouth that envelops the aircraft’s cockpit. Its entry into service comes after a five-year development period in which it logged over 200 test flights and received its European Aviation Safety Agency type certification in November 2019, two months before its introduction to Airbus’s fleet. The OEM anticipates all six of the new Belugas will be operational by the end of 2023. ROBERT WILLIAMSON | FIREFIGHTING NEWS Firefighters of all stripes face danger on a daily basis. Airborne crews are not immune from that danger, and the world was reminded of this sad fact on Jan. 23, when B.C.-headquartered Coulson Aviation confirmed that one of its C-130 large airtankers had crashed while working under contract to the New South Wales Rural Fire Service (NSW RFS) in Australia. All three American crew members perished in the accident that occurred on Jan. 22 during a firebombing mission in the Snowy Monaro Area of southern New South Wales. NSW premier Gladys Berejiklian addressed the media after the incident, saying, “Today is a stark and horrible reminder of the dangerous conditions that our volunteers and emergency services personnel across a number of agencies undertake on a daily basis.” As of Jan. 27, there had been 25 fire season fatalities in NSW, including the three aboard the Coulson C-130. Australia’s worst fire season in recent memory began in late October 2019, and so far has burned 12.35 million acres of land. In a show of support, Canada has deployed close to 100 firefighting specialists to help battle the fires, many of whom left in December and sacrificed time with their families over the holidays. On Jan. 28, a Royal Canadian Air Force CC-177 Globemaster III transport aircraft departed for Australia via the U.S., where it was scheduled to pick up a load of fire retardant. The aircraft was expected to alleviate some of the demand on Australian military aircraft for a few days. Other Canadian aircraft have been there since the fires began, including those belonging to Coulson Aviation, a subsidiary of the Coulson Group based out of Port Alberni, B.C. The company has sent a wide array of aircraft to battle the wildfires, including two Boeing 737 Fireliners, a pair of C-130 Hercules airtankers (including the one that crashed), three Sikorsky S-61 helicopters and an S-76 helicopter. “If we had more to bring, they would be over there,” said Britton Coulson, co-president of the Coulson Group. It’s the company’s 19 th year fighting fires in Australia, and the company has crews stationed there year-round. Along with Coulson, Abbotsford, B.C.- based Conair has its Avro RJ85 AT aircraft contracted to help combat the fires, which have killed an estimated one billion animals and destroyed over 2,500 homes. The shift work has been gruelling, as firefighters have been battling blazes for upwards of 12 hours per day, and while the logistical work is nowhere near as terrifying, according to Coulson there is still plenty that needs to be done to get aircraft to places in need. “It’s a lot of co-ordination, it’s a lot of trip permits [and] it’s a lot of fuel permits,” he said. The conditions of the island nation are known to be challenging, especially to aerial firefighters, with high temperatures and now, with the raging fires, a busy air traffic environment. To help manage these conditions, Coulson often flies at night using special equipment. “The big benefit of night vision goggle fire- fighting is the temperatures are down over the day,” explained Coulson. “Typically, the relative humidity is higher at night than it is during the day, so you’ve got lower temps and higher relative humidity, which are both good for firefighting, and then usu- ally you have less wind. And then the fact that during the day, especially when we’re talking about Australia … the airspace is so congested with air tankers and helicopters that it’s less efficient than it could be.” At this point, Australia is still in its sum- mer season, meaning it could be months before it sees any relief from cooler tem- peratures. Until then, it seems as though Canadians are willing to tough it out and provide assistance in any way they can. This is Coulson Aviation’s 19th year fighting fires in Australia. On Jan. 22, one of its C-130 Hercules airtankers crashed while on a firebombing mission and the company lost three of its team members. World Calibre Emergency Aviation “ you will walk the earth with your “For once you have tasted flight eyes turned skywards, for there you have been and there you will long to return...” Leonardo da Vinci www.marinvent.com Find tools & solutions to certify complex problems in aerospace www.certcentercanda.com SKIESMAG.COM February/March 2020 26 BRIEFING ROOM | AVIATION INDUSTRY NEWS KEN POLE | SAFETY NEWS Nearly five years after an Air Canada Airbus A320-211 crashed short of the runway at Halifax Stanfield International Airport, the legal battle continues over whether cockpit voice recorder data should be released to both sides in a class-action lawsuit. The Canadian Transportation Accident Investigation and Safety Board Act states that “every on-board recording is privileged” but a Nova Scotia Supreme Court judge directed the Transportation Safety Board of Canada (TSB) to release the recordings as well as any transcripts. However, TSB spokesperson Chris Krepski has told Skies that the agency not only wants the ruling by Justice Patrick Duncan stayed but also would be appealing. The filing was confirmed by Kate Boyle, a member of the class actions group within the Halifax-based law firm Wagners. The Nova Scotia Court of Appeal set Feb. 6 for a hearing on the TSB’s request that the motion should be stayed and June 9 for a hearing on the appeal. The TSB and the Air Canada Pilots Association (ACPA) would not comment further on the specifics of the case. The TSB’s Krepski said only that “as this is a matter before the courts, the TSB will not make further comments,” while his ACPA counterpart, Julie Rolph, would only reiterate the organization’s disappointment at Duncan’s ruling. Rolph did cite an affidavit submitted to the court by Capt David Cadieux, chair of ACPA’s flight safety division, which states that “the privacy of pilots should be protected, especially when personal information incidental to events is recorded.” Cadieux also said that “as the privilege . . . is eroded, so too is the vital ability of pilots to speak freely while flying and while dealing with emerging in-flight issues, a prospect that raises broader and significant safety concerns.” Five crewmembers and 133 passengers were aboard AC 624 from Toronto on a non-precision approach at 12:30 a.m. on March 29, 2015. According to the TSB report, the aircraft “severed power lines, then struck the snow-covered ground about 740 feet before the runway threshold.” It “continued airborne through the localizer antenna array, then struck the ground twice more before sliding along the runway,” coming to rest “about 1,900 feet beyond the threshold.” There was no fire but the Airbus was a write-off. The TSB report found that the aircrew – identified in the court documents as John Doe #1 and John Doe #2 – had not monitored altitude and distance from the threshold and had not adjusted to the flight path angle once they had begun their descent. It also noted that the “challenging conditions” made it likely that the crew delayed disconnecting the autopilot “until beyond the minimum descent altitude” and that “reduced brightness of the approach and runway lights” had “diminished the flight crew’s ability” to notice that they were short of the runway. Twenty-five people required hospital treatment for what Air Canada described at the time as “observation and treatment of minor injuries.” The class action lawsuit, alleging negligence causing injury and seeking compensation, was filed against Air Canada, Airbus, voice recorder data from AC 624 Battle continues over cockpit According to the TSB report, AC 624 “severed power lines, then struck the snow-covered ground about 740 feet before the runway threshold.” TSB Photo SKIESMAG.COM February/March 2020 27 For m o r e n e w s u p d a t e s , v i s i t SKIESMAG.COM the airport authority and the federal government. The TSB and ACPA were granted intervenor status. The statement of claim filed by Wagners alleges that the aircrew ignored regulatory runway approach minimums, opted not to divert to another airport, did not request weather updates from air traffic control, did not follow ATC instructions, did not declare an emergency “in a timely manner” and had operated the Airbus “without due care and skill despite knowing that damage would probably result.” The statement also alleged negligence not only by the airport authority with regard to runway lighting but also by Nav Canada for what the plaintiffs’ lawyers say included “a failure to inform the flight crew of unsafe weather conditions, unserviceable equipment and poor visibility.” Moreover, Airbus allegedly failed “to provide adequate instructions and training” on “systems that would be pertinent to the possible causes of the accident” and Transport Canada “failed to fulfill its responsibility as an industry regulator, including how it assessed and approved Air Canada’s non-precision approach procedures.” In addition to the plaintiffs in the class action, Airbus, the airport authority and Nav Canada asked that the TSB hand over the recording and any transcripts, but the board claimed statutory privilege. But Justice Duncan, who heard arguments last July, stated in his November written ruling that “statutorily prescribed exceptions” in the legislation mean the definition of “privilege” is limited in scope. “The necessary implication is that the TSB can, subject to statute, communicate contents that are related to the causes or the identification of safety deficiencies. . . . In the circumstances of this case, the public interest in the administration of justice outweighs the importance attached to the statutory privilege protecting the cockpit voice recorder.” CVR data were an issue after the August 2005 crash of Air France Flight 358, an Airbus A340-313 arriving from Paris at Toronto International Airport, ran off the end of the runway and crashed into a ravine. On final approach, the crew received a report from an aircraft ahead that heavy precipitation was compromising runway traction. Approximately 320 feet above the ground, the crew took manual control but crossed the threshold 40 feet above the glide slope and landed 3,800 feet down the 8,000-foot runway. Two crewmembers and 10 passengers were seriously injured and the plane was destroyed by fire. Justice Duncan pointed out that in hearing a case brought by Air France against the Toronto airport authority, Ontario Chief Justice George Strathy, faced with “the same balancing exercise” and noting that one pilot had not objected, had ordered the CVR data released because it included “highly relevant, probative and reliable evidence that is central to the issues in the litigation.” Editor’s Note: An unofficial CVR data poll posted on the Skies Facebook page on Jan. 6 elicited a tremendous response, logging well over 800 votes. Interestingly, respondents were closely divided, with 56 per cent saying CVR data should be made available to judicial inquiries and 44 per cent taking the opposite point of view. C ONVERGENT SKIESMAG.COM February/March 2020 28 BRIEFING ROOM | AVIATION INDUSTRY NEWS CHRIS THATCHER | MILITARY NEWS While the Royal Canadian Air Force Directorate of Flight Safety continues its investigation into the crash of a CT-114 Tutor Snowbird enroute to the Atlanta Air Show last October, the Canadi-an Armed Forces Air Demonstration team has resumed flying in preparation for the 2020 airshow season. Pilots with 431 Air Demonstration Squadron at 15 Wing Moose Jaw, Sask., began training flights on Dec. 6, 2019, following an operational pause that grounded the Snowbird fleet and pushed back pre-season preparation by about one month. The Snowbirds are slated to begin their airshow schedule on June 6 and 7 at Selfridge Air Force Base in Michigan, but that start date could be changed if the demo team feels it still needs more preparation. “We have offset our season so we can have roughly the same amount of training that we normally have every year,” said Maj Jean-Francois Dupont, the team lead known as Snowbird 1. “But we need to be flexible because there are so many changes.” In addition to the flying pause, the nine-person team is introducing two new pilots, one of whom is still being confirmed. Dupont, also the deputy commander of the squadron, cautioned that while winter training is progressing, it’s too early to assess when the team will be ready. “As we get closer to (spring training in Comox) in May, we’ll have a good idea if we can start the show season on time, or if we need to delay a little more,” he explained. “Our goal is to make an exciting and safe show, so if we have any doubts or anyone is struggling to get to that point, we will delay the show season as required.” In a typical pre-season, the Snowbirds will complete between 80 and 100 missions during the winter months before starting spring training at 19 Wing Comox, B.C. Those numbers vary depending on weather and aircraft availability, but “our goal is not to scale that back,” said Dupont, who previously flew as Snowbird No. 2 for the 2010 to 2012 seasons. He noted, however, that as temperatures plummeted below -35 C in early January, aircraft were more difficult to start and operate, further slowing down some of the training. “It is really tough on the pilots and the ground crew to get the jet ready when it is really cold. We take our time. We make sure we don’t rush anyone. So it slows everyone down and makes the day longer. And when it is really cold, we [limit] our range from the airport just so we stay safe.” Flight safety investigators have yet to pinpoint exactly what caused the CT-114 to lose engine thrust as the team was flying to an airshow at the Atlanta Motor Speedway in Hampton, Ga., on Oct. 13, 2019. The pilot, Capt Kevin Domon-Grenier of Saint-Raymond de Portneuf, Que., lost engine power shortly after a routine check while inverted and opted to eject after determining the aircraft was too low to attempt a safe recovery to an airport. He ejected successfully, sustaining minor injuries, but “reported anomalies with the ejection sequence,” according to an occurrence summary by investigators. John Chung Photo SKIESMAG.COM February/March 2020 30 BRIEFING ROOM | AVIATION INDUSTRY NEWS CHRIS THATCHER | MILITARY NEWS The Royal Canadian Air Force (RCAF) recently completed a “tail swap” of three of its CH-146 Griffon helicopters supporting Operation Impact, Canada’s training mission in Iraq. The three Griffons were part of the tac- tical aviation detachment (TAD) of about 50 personnel based near Baghdad, pro- viding logistical support and transport to the commander and head-quarters staff of NATO Mission Iraq, a multinational effort led by Canadian MGen Jennie Carignan to strengthen the capacity of Iraqi security forces. The routine changeover of the three heli- copters was done “to ensure deeper main- tenance is completed and wear on the engine and airframe is consistent across the fleet,” explained a spokesperson for Canadian Joint Operations Command. “A tail swap is done as part of the regu- lar maintenance cycle where aircraft are inspected at different hours flown mile- stones. Throughout this cycle, there are different levels of inspection required, and when the routine inspection exceeds the capacity of the deployed TAD, a tail swap is conducted for the maintenance to be done back in Canada without an interruption to operations.” To support the NATO mission, the three Griffons are equipped with standard pro- tection such as the C6, GAU 21 or Dillon M134 machine guns, but they don’t have a MX-15 camera or other sensors normally fitted to conduct reconnaissance, close air support or convoy escort. The RCAF also operates a detachment of up to four CH-146 helicopters based in the northern Iraqi city of Erbil to support a Canadian Special Operations Forces mission. Both TADs are com- prised primarily of aircrew, maintainers and support staff from 408 Tactical Helicopter Squadron in Edmonton. The Canadian Armed Forces (CAF) temporarily paused all training activities of Iraqi forces and moved some of its personnel to Kuwait following the United States assassination of Iranian Gen Qassem Soleimani, head of its elite Quds Force, on Jan. 3 and the Iranian retaliato- ry ballistic missile attack on Iraqi bases housing U.S. troops on Jan. 7. The CAF would not disclose whether CH-146 aircrews and maintainers were part of that repositioning. “For security reasons, we will not provide more spe- cific details as to movements of CAF personnel in the region,” said a spokes- person for the Department of National Defence (DND) in an email. The CAF has deployed about 850 Regular and Reserve personnel into four countries — Iraq, Jordan, Lebanon and Kuwait — as part of Op Impact, including around 200 for the NATO Mission in Iraq. The majori- ty are from 3 Canadian Division, which is principally based out of CFB Edmonton. While training activities remained suspended as of Jan. 24, some mission critical activities such as air sustainment operations resumed in mid-January, according to DND, and personnel “remain ready to return to their mission when conditions are right to do so.” The tactical aviation detachment at Camp Taji airfield about 30 kilometres north of Baghdad was established in January 2019 by 438 Tactical Helicopter Squadron from St. Hubert, Que. It was a rare overseas deployment for the total force air reserve squadron, made up of more than 50 per cent reservists, and an indication of how stretched 1 Wing had become at the time, supporting multiple missions in Iraq, Mali and at home. Just once before in the history of Canadian tactical aviation had an aviation detachment comprised of at least 40 per cent reservists conducted overseas operations. in NATO Mission Iraq Griffons continue to perform Canada has deployed about 850 Regular and Reserve personnel into four countries as part of Op Impact, including around 200 for the NATO Mission in Iraq. Any new airliner that can attract customers and operate economically is bound to generate revenues and produce profits for its operator. That is why Air Canada’s A220-300 is so attractive. A survey of its cabin reveals a comfortable environment. Up front, the business class cabin has 12 seats (three rows, four abreast) that feature a 37 inch/94 cm pitch. Further aft, the economy class cabin’s 125 seats (25 rows, five abreast) each have a 30 inch/76 cm pitch. At 19 inches, the Y-class seats are the widest in AC’s fleet – albeit one inch wider than the rest. The spacious feel to the entire cabin is due to its wider aisle, windows that are 50 per cent larger than those of an A320, and 15 per cent bigger overhead bins. When you consider the new Panasonic in-flight entertainment system that features a 12-inch screen in the economy cabin and mood lighting, you sense that some passengers may not wish to deplane at their destination. Financial folks will be pleased with the A220-300’s impressive operating SKIESMAG.COM February/March 2020 35 FEATURE | THE A220 IN CANADA cost metrics. Its new Pratt & Whitney PW1500G geared turbofan engines, also produced in Mirabel, enable the airplane to burn 20 per cent less fuel per mile flown compared to previous generation models. The jet also produces 20 per cent fewer CO2 emissions and has as much as a 50 per cent smaller noise footprint. It is an exemplary corporate citizen. A key attribute of the aircraft is its impressive range. Thanks to its less thirsty engines, an A220-300 can fly 3,200 nautical miles (nm). That is 33 per cent further than the 2,400 nm that a sim- ilarly-sized Airbus A320-200 can travel. AIR CANADA’S INTENTIONS By May 4, the airline expects to have received eight A220-300s. That day it will be using the aircraft to initiate two city-pairs: Montreal - Seattle, Wash., and Toronto - San Jose, Calif. With stage lengths/block times of 1,985 nm/5:50 and 1,950 nm/5:30, respectively, these new routes will permit the aircraft to demonstrate its transcontinental range capability. By the end of 2020, Air Canada expects to have 17 units in service. It plans on utilizing the airplane on new long and thin routes that can’t support On Jan. 16, Air Canada operated its first A220 revenue flight between Montreal and Calgary. Patrick Cardinal Photo By May 4, the airline expects to have received eight A220-300s. The aircraft’s impressive range will open up new routes for Air Canada. Here, pilots train in the simulator. Brian Losito Photo WATCH THE VIDEO HERE larger models; to increase frequencies on key spokes into its hubs at Toronto, Montreal and Vancouver; and to provide appropriate gauge on seasonal services. Other potential new city-pairs include Vancouver - Halifax and Vancouver - Washington, D.C. Regardless of how it may ultimately be deployed, the A220- 300 is expected to act as a market share disruptor by diverting competitors’ passenger traffic to Air Canada. A LATE BLOOMER MATURES What began as Bombardier’s new Commercial Aircraft Program in early 2004 has evolved into an extremely successful airliner in the 100-to-150 seat niche. By the end of 2019, 600 A220s had been ordered. Included in that tally were 95 A220-100s and 505 of the larger A220-300s. Aircraft delivered by the end of 2019 totalled 105, including 37 A220-100s and 68 A220-300s. The A220-100 owners included Delta (28) and Swiss International (nine). A220-300 owners were Air Canada (one), Air Baltic (22), Air Tanzania (two), Egyptair (seven), State Transport Leasing of Russia (six), Korean Air (10) and Swiss International (20). BOMBARDIER QUESTIONS A220 COMMITMENT Since July 1, 2018, the A220 program has been owned by Airbus SE (50.01 per cent), Bombardier Inc. (34 per cent) and Investissement Quebec (16 per cent). But on Jan. 16, 2020, Bombardier warned investors that it may exit its joint venture with Airbus to produce the A220 airliner. In its preliminary fourth-quarter report, the Canadian OEM said it’s anticipating a US$130 million loss for the period, which may force it to sell off assets in order to pay down debt – one of which is its stake in the A220 commercial aviation venture. In the report, Bombardier remarked that while the A220 program “continues to win in the marketplace and demonstrate its value to airlines,” the Airbus Canada Limited Partnership (ACLP) – the name of its joint program with Airbus – had made the call for additional cash investments to support production ramp-up. In turn, that would extend the timeline for the program to break even and potentially generate a lower profit margin over the life of the partnership. “With its exit from commercial aerospace, Bombardier is reassessing its ongoing participation in ACLP,” the company said in the statement. In the original deal, Bombardier agreed to fund the program with up to $925 million over a three-and-a-half-year span. Since Airbus’s acquisition of the former C Series aircraft family, the company has delivered 105 aircraft out of 600 total orders. Now, Bombardier is contemplating extricating itself from the program entirely, even though it’s invested $6 billion into the A220 venture, in an effort to shed further costs. The announcement sunk the company’s stock by nearly 32 per cent on the Toronto Stock Exchange on Jan. 16. As a result, Moody’s Investors Services – an American credit rating agency – changed Bombardier’s rating outlook from stable to negative. The statement about the partnership with Airbus came just after Air Canada celebrated the entry into service of its first A220-300. All of this follows a four-year stretch that has seen Bombardier sell off most of its aviation assets in a turnaround plan aimed at levelling off costs, leaving the company with only its rail and business aviation divisions. In its preliminary fourth-quarter financial report, Bombardier said it will be providing additional information when it reports its 2019 financial results on Feb. 13. FREDERICK K. LARKIN Frederick K. Harbour Air Seaplanes Photo ELECTRI-BY HOWARD SLUTSKEN WATCH THE VIDEO HERE n Dec. 10, 2019, aviation history was made in Canada as the world’s first electrically-powered commercial passenger aircraft flew at Vancouver International Airport (YVR). In a marriage of old and new technology, a 63-year-old de Havilland Canada DHC-2 Beaver floatplane, powered by an advanced MagniX electric propulsion system, lifted off from the airport’s floatplane terminal for its first test flight on a mostly cloudy West Coast morning. At the controls of the modified Harbour Air plane was Greg McDougall, an 8,000-hour Beaver pilot and the airline’s CEO and founder. Instead of a Pratt & Whitney radial piston engine or a P&W Canada PT6 turbine, the “ePlane” was powered by a magni500 electric motor capable of generating as much as 560 kilowatts, or 750 horsepower. To match the power of a stock, piston Beaver, the propulsion system was de-rated to the electric equivalent of 450 HP. As McDougall pulled the plane “onto the step” and flew off for a short, four-minute test flight, the plane’s four-bladed Hartzell composite propeller generated all of the remarkably quiet takeoff sound – a fraction of the thunder from the legacy Beaver’s radial piston. “I didn’t have time to really do too much experimenting with different flight configurations. We were limited by the weather,” explained McDougall in an interview with Skies. Although the battery-powered ePlane was at its 5,600-pound maximum gross weight, McDougall was surprised by the performance of the electric propulsion system’s instant torque. With a large group of international media watching and a helicopter camera ship following, he had planned to lift off at a specific target to make sure everyone had the perfect “photo op.” “But I had to throttle it back on takeoff because the plane lifted off a lot quicker, even with the eight or nine knot tailwind blowing.” As a technology demonstrator, the ePlane won’t be carrying passengers – there isn’t room for seats in a cabin that’s filled with lithium-ion batteries – and it will only have a 15-minute endurance with a 25-minute reserve. “Those are batteries that NASA is using, but they’re not batteries that we’d use if we were going to try and make it economical to fly today, because O SKIESMAG.COM February/March 2020 39 I-FLYING Not so long ago, the idea of electric commercial aviation was a decidedly futuristic notion. But last December, B.C.-based Harbour Air and MagniX made a giant leap forward with the first flight of their DHC-2 Beaver “ePlane.” We take a look at what’s next. FEATURE | ELECTRIC COMMERCIAL AVIATION SKIESMAG.COM February/March 2020 40 FEATURE | ELECTRIC COMMERCIAL AVIATION they’re very low in watt-hours per kilogram,” said McDougall. The energy density – the power to weight ratio – of today’s batteries is a key factor for aircraft electrification, as is the shape and size of each unit. While there may be other battery solutions with higher energy density and a smaller form factor, Harbour Air and MagniX are being cautious. “They are batteries that have been to space,” said McDougall. “So, if you’re choosing a battery for a prototype, then that’s the one you choose.” A PIONEERING PLATFORM The electric Beaver floatplane launches McDougall’s quest to make Vancouver- based Harbour Air a fully-electric airline, building on its more than 12 years as North America’s first carbon neutral airline. He explained that as novel as it is, the electric powerplant certification is not unlike the process needed to gain approval for a new engine, such as the Beaver’s conversion from a piston to a turbine. “The Beaver is the platform where we can get the Transport Canada regulatory process started, because the pathway to certification at this point doesn’t exist. It has to be pioneered,” said McDougall. “All we should have to demonstrate is that the electric propulsion system is as safe or better than the technology we’re currently using. We don’t feel that’s hard to do, but it’s new and it hasn’t been done before,” he added. While the ePlane continues its flight tests, the first phase of the approval process will take place in the U.S., where MagniX will certify the components of the electric propulsion system under Federal Aviation Administration (FAA) regulations. Once that’s complete, phase two will see the certification of Harbour Air’s installation, with the support of Transport Canada. “The Government of Canada believes that the electrification of transportation is a key part of Canada’s transition to a low-carbon economy,” said a spokesperson in an email to Skies. “The Canadian Aviation Regulations allow the department to certify novel or unusual designs such as electric propulsion aircraft, through the development of special conditions-airworthiness, as required.” After a review of the electric propulsion system, Transport Canada authorized the ePlane’s first test flight, and the department “will support the design certification initiative once the company is ready to enter that phase of the project.” McDougall said that Harbour Air has briefed the Minister of Transport’s office, and that the ePlane has received “a tre- mendous amount of attention from the [British Columbia] provincial government.” Once certified, Harbour Air will hold the worldwide supplementary type certificate (STC) for the Beaver conversion and will look to extending the technology to the rest of its fleet. ALICE…IN WONDERLAND Remarkably, it’s only taken MagniX two years to take the magni500 from an idea to an engine flying in a commercial aircraft. “It’s amazing what you can do when you take talented, passionate people and say, ‘You have no constraints to your thinking,’” said Roei Ganzarski, CEO of MagniX. “Of course, we didn’t invent the electric motor, but we innovated an existing technology and made it aerospace-worthy.” The “magni-fied” electric Beaver performed better during its first flight than ground testing had suggested, according to Ganzarski. Even when you test things on the ground, it’s academic in nature until you actually fly.” With headquarters in Seattle, Wash., and engineering centres in Seattle and on Australia’s Gold Coast, MagniX is developing motors generating 375, 750 and 1,500 horsepower. The MagniX system is “power agnostic” – the source of the electrons doesn’t matter to the motors. Electricity for future aviation solutions could come from batteries, hydrogen fuel cells, or a fuel-powered generator. MagniX’s next prototype aircraft, a magni500-powered Cessna Grand Caravan, is targeted to fly in the first quarter of 2020. As a pure test aircraft, the Cessna is dedicated to wring out the propulsion system in the air, at its full 560 kilowatt/750-horsepower rating. And then there’s Eviation’s Alice – a clean-sheet, nine-passenger, all- electric aircraft that’s been designed around the capabilities of an electric propulsion system. Alice is a futuristic-looking tri-motor, with a propulsor at the tip of each high-aspect-ratio wing and a pusher- prop in the fuselage under a high V-tail. Elegantly curved, the sleek Alice looks fast just sitting on its main and tail landing gear. The fly-by-wire, all composite aircraft will cruise at 240 knots, with a 650-mile range. The first Alice is undergoing initial systems integration and taxi testing in Prescott, Ariz., and Ganzarski hopes the plane will begin flight testing this summer in Moses Lake, Wash. (Update: An electrical system fire on Jan. 22 significantly damaged the prototype, and the impact on the flight schedule was unknown at press time.) “What Eviation has been able to do with the Alice is truly optimize the aircraft to be electric – for example, how many batteries, and where you put them in the aircraft. As you can imagine, building a brand new aircraft has added a level of complexity versus magni-fying one.” FUTURE FEEDERS?
